## Approvals: Queue Migration

Replacing the homegrown Taskmill job queue with Drovebeam requires two approvals: one from platform engineering and one from the data-integrity group. Migration proceeds in three phases, with rollback checkpoints after each. Schema mappings are documented in the migration appendix. Final cutover cannot be scheduled until written approval is granted by the authority named below.

approver of yawig-yajef = Briius Jorix

Minutes — Management Meeting

Prepared for the incoming director. Topic: possible acquisition of Greyfen Analytics. Due diligence 70% complete. Valuation gap remains; Greyfen seeks a premium. Integration risks flagged by Ops. Decision deferred to next month. Talla Nyberg leads negotiations. Our walk-away position is stated below.

board note of fawig-kagup: Only 48 of the 435 pilot accounts renewed Rusion, so a churn review is set for September 12. Fenwynox Logistics is in early talks to buy Sorielek Systems for about $117.8 million.

## Known issue: flaky DNS in the Hatchwork plugin sandbox

Plugin authors occasionally see intermittent resolution failures when the sandbox resolver times out under load. This is a known issue; retries with backoff usually succeed within two attempts. Do not hardcode resolver addresses as a workaround. If your plugin publishes artifacts from the sandbox, sign them before upload. The sandbox publishing key is provided below.

signing key of bagap-yawep = bky13_TbfT6ZMUoGJo2

Runbook: Account recovery — NudgeWell reminder job

New folks: if the clinic reminder job stops sending, it's usually because the service account got locked after a credential rotation. Don't panic. Re-enable the account in the scheduler console, then re-run the morning batch manually. To unlock the account's sealed credential store, enter the recovery phrase shown below.

vault phrase of bagaf-kajeg = jorath-feniel-briir-siliel-ralix